I have organized Paradigm High's first chess club and chess team. Right now I only have about six regulars, but I haven't really started advertising, and expect a decent increase in upcoming weeks.
The chess club is open to anyone, and includes information on how to play (from beginning to advanced strategy) and is being used as a teaching tool as well as an opportunity to play others experienced in the game. The chess team is much more competitive, and will travel to different scholastic and High School tournaments (including the High School Championship in April), and will consist of a) anybody willing to take the time and money out of their lives to go to tournaments, or b) the top four players in the chess club, depending on how many players show up at the club.
